# Env file — Larkspur autocomplete service (release candidate)
# The autocomplete index has been rebuilding slowly since the tokenizer
# upgrade; full rebuilds now take ~40 minutes, so schedule deploys
# accordingly and never restart mid-rebuild. Release manager: verify the
# index version matches the manifest before promoting. The indexer also
# needs its store credential defined in this file, so set it on the next line.

sealed setting: RELAY_SECRET5=82864

**Vendor note: Inkmill markdown pipeline**

Rendering for Parchway docs is outsourced to Inkmill under an annual contract, renewing each March. They handle sanitization and PDF export; we own the upload queue. SLA: 4-hour response on rendering failures. Escalate only after two failed retries. Their support desk is reachable at the address below.

billing contact of hahaf-baguf = zorael.tammir.jorius@sivrelhq.internal

**Ticket: Config drift on PedalShift rebalancer**

Prod nodes in the Velden region are running stale truck-capacity thresholds. Staging matches the repo; prod does not. Rebalancing vans are being dispatched half-empty since Tuesday. No manual changes logged. Likely a failed sync from the config push last sprint. The current live values on prod are as follows.

service settings:
PRAIX_LOG_LEVEL=error
PRAIX_METRICS_HOST=metrics.praix.qorvelcorp.corp
PRAIX_POOL_SIZE=16

Subject: Bounce processor release — Harbormail 3.2

Team, the updated email bounce processor is staged and ready for sign-off. This release changes how soft bounces are retried: we now back off exponentially over 48 hours instead of retrying hourly, which should stop the suppression-list churn we saw last month. Dariusz has verified the migration on staging with a replay of last week's bounce log. Please confirm the rollout window before Friday. The trace token for the staged build appears below.

build token for kagaf-hahof: htk14_9d3d4d26d7d8de